已知8253的Cho用作计数器,口地址为40H,计数频率为2MHz。控制字寄存器口地址为43H,计数器回0时输出信号用作中断请求信号,执行下列程序段后,发出中断请求信号的周期是【 】。
MOV AL,36H
OUT 43H,AL
MOV AL,OFFH
OUT 40H,AL
OUT 40H,AL
第1题:
8254的计数器0端口地址为280H,计数器1的端口地址为282H,则控制口的地址为()
A.284H
B.286H
C.285H
D.288H
第2题:
8253端口地址为40H~43H,通道0作为计数器,计数时钟频率为1MHz。下面程序段执行后,输出波形的周期是______ms。 MOV AL, 36H OUT 43H, AL MOV AX, 20000 OUT 40H, AL MOV AL, AH OUT 40H, AL
第3题:
某8254占用端口地址为40H ~ 43H,其中计数器2工作在方式 0,初值为4020H,二进制计数,试编写读出计数器2当前计数值的程序段。
第4题:
设外部有一脉冲信号源PLUS,要求用8253的计数器0对该信号源连续计数,当计数器计为0时向CPU发出中断请求。 1) 画出8253的CLK0、GATE0和OUT0的信号连接图。 2) 若,8253的端口地址为40H~43H,计数初值为1234,写出该计数器工作在方式2按二进制计数的初始化程序。 3)若计数初值为123450,在上述基础上增加计数器1如何连接以实现计数。
第5题:
已知某可编程接口芯片中计数器的端口地址为40H,控制口的端口地址为43H,计数频率为2MHz。计数器到0值的输出信号用做中断请求信号,执行下列程序后,发出中断请求信号的周期是多少? MOV AL,00110110B OUT 43H,AL MOV AL,0FFH OUT 40H,AL OUT 40H,AL